导读: Excel是一款功能强大的电子表格软件,在日常工作和学习中经常被使用。有时候我们可能会遇到需要将Excel表格的行和列进行转换的情况,这可以提供更直观和方便的数据展示和分析。本文将介绍几种方法来实现Excel表格的行列转换。
方法一:使用Excel自带的转置功能
Excel自带了一个...
Excel是一款功能强大的电子表格软件,在日常工作和学习中经常被使用。有时候我们可能会遇到需要将Excel表格的行和列进行转换的情况,这可以提供更直观和方便的数据展示和分析。本文将介绍几种方法来实现Excel表格的行列转换。
方法一:使用Excel自带的转置功能
Excel自带了一个转置功能,可以帮助我们快捷地将表格的行列进行转换。
- 选中要转换的数据区域。
- 点击Excel的开始选项卡,在剪贴板组中找到转置按钮。
- 点击转置按钮,弹出的对话框中选择转置选项,并点击确定。
- 转置后的数据将出现在你选择的目标位置。
方法二:使用公式进行手动转置
如果你对Excel的公式比较熟悉,你也可以使用公式来手动转置表格的行列。
- 在目标位置空白区域选择与要转换的数据区域一样大小的区域。
- 在第一个单元格中输入以下公式:=转置(要转换的数据区域)。
- 按下Ctrl+Shift+Enter组合键,这是因为这个公式是一个数组公式。
- 转置后的数据将出现在你选择的目标位置。
方法三:使用宏来进行转置
如果你经常需要将Excel表格行列进行转换,可以使用宏来自动完成这个过程。
- 按下Alt+F11,打开Visual Basic for Applications编辑器。
- 在插入菜单中选择模块。
- 在模块中输入以下宏代码:
Sub TransposeData()
Selection.Copy
Sheets.Add After:=Sheets(Sheets.Count)
ActiveSheet.Paste
Application.CutCopyMode = False
Selection.Copy
Selection.PasteSpecial Paste:=xlPasteAll, Operation:=xlNone, SkipBlanks:= _
False, Transpose:=True
End Sub
- 按下F5运行宏。
- 转置后的数据将出现在新添加的工作表中。
以上是三种常用的将Excel表格行列进行转换的方法。根据你的具体需求,选择其中一种方法即可快速、方便地完成转换。
感谢您阅读本文,希望能为您带来帮助!
转载请注明出处:admin,如有疑问,请联系(762063026)。
本文地址:https://office-vip.com/post/28201.html